Wrentham Public Schools is seeking an experienced special education teacher who can facilitate the academic and social-behavioral needs of elementary students who have been identified with developmental and social-communication disabilities, including Autism.

As a member of the Individualized Learning Center Team, the special education teacher will provide specialized instruction to assist students in decreasing challenging behaviors that prevent them from developing to their full potential, while systematically increasing appropriate self-regulation strategies and socially appropriate behaviors so they can access the general education environment to the fullest extent possible.

Specific Responsibilities:
* Maintain all responsibilities of a special education liaison in regards to evaluation and IEP development within mandated timelines
* Facilitate individual students’ academic, self-regulation, and social-behavioral programs based on their IEP goals
* Develop and implement individual Behavior Intervention Plans; graph and analyze data collected to monitor student progress.
* Consult regularly with related service therapists, counseling staff, BCBA, and classroom teachers to ensure consistency of behavioral approaches across settings
* Supervise and provide ongoing training to ABA tutors and paraprofessionals
* Provide ongoing parent communication, consultation, and training as needed
*Facilitate the transition from grade 3 in one building to grade 4 in another building
